2026/1/25 0:36:47
网站建设
项目流程
微网官方网站,网店网页设计培训,山东省住房城乡和建设厅网站首页,临沭网站建设ArtPlayer实战指南#xff1a;从零构建企业级视频播放解决方案 【免费下载链接】ArtPlayer :art: ArtPlayer.js is a modern and full featured HTML5 video player 项目地址: https://gitcode.com/gh_mirrors/ar/ArtPlayer
你是否曾经为了在网页中嵌入一个功能完善的视…ArtPlayer实战指南从零构建企业级视频播放解决方案【免费下载链接】ArtPlayer:art: ArtPlayer.js is a modern and full featured HTML5 video player项目地址: https://gitcode.com/gh_mirrors/ar/ArtPlayer你是否曾经为了在网页中嵌入一个功能完善的视频播放器而头疼不已从兼容性问题到复杂的配置再到各种插件集成每一个环节都可能成为技术路上的绊脚石。今天就让我们一同探索ArtPlayer这款强大的HTML5视频播放器看看它是如何帮助开发者轻松应对这些挑战的。痛点直击为什么你需要ArtPlayer在Web开发中视频播放功能的实现往往面临诸多难题跨浏览器兼容性不同浏览器对视频格式的支持差异巨大经常出现在这个浏览器能播那个就不行的尴尬局面。移动端适配困难小屏设备上的手势操作、播放控制都需要额外开发。功能扩展复杂弹幕、画中画、多字幕等高级功能都需要从头开发。ArtPlayer正是为了解决这些问题而生它提供了一整套完整的视频播放解决方案。横向对比ArtPlayer与其他播放器的差异在众多HTML5视频播放器中ArtPlayer以其独特的设计理念脱颖而出 与Video.js对比ArtPlayer更加轻量级代码结构更清晰学习成本更低。 与原生video标签对比ArtPlayer提供了丰富的API和插件生态让开发者能够快速实现复杂功能。 与商业播放器对比完全开源免费没有功能限制和授权费用。实战演练手把手搭建播放环境环境准备首先通过GitCode获取最新源码git clone https://gitcode.com/gh_mirrors/ar/ArtPlayer基础配置实例让我们通过一个实际案例来展示ArtPlayer的强大之处// 创建播放器实例 const player new Artplayer({ container: #video-container, url: assets/sample/video.mp4, poster: assets/sample/poster.jpg, volume: 0.5, autoSize: true, autoMini: true, screenshot: true, setting: true, hotkey: true, mutex: true, fullscreen: true, fullscreenWeb: true, subtitleOffset: true, miniProgressBar: true, localVideo: true, networkMonitor: true });移动端适配技巧ArtPlayer针对移动设备进行了深度优化手势操作支持滑动调节音量、亮度、进度自适应布局根据屏幕尺寸自动调整控制栏大小播放优化小屏模式下的播放体验更加流畅进阶应用企业级场景解决方案在线教育平台对于在线教育场景ArtPlayer可以轻松集成视频加密播放学习进度记录弹幕互动功能多字幕支持直播应用在直播场景中ArtPlayer同样表现出色低延迟播放实时弹幕多清晰度切换播放统计性能优化让你的播放器更快更稳加载策略优化const art new Artplayer({ container: .artplayer-app, url: video.m3u8, whitelist: [*], moreVideoAttr: { crossOrigin: anonymous }, autoPlayback: true });内存管理建议及时销毁不再使用的播放器实例合理设置缓存大小使用懒加载技术最佳实践避免常见坑点配置陷阱❌ 错误做法一次性加载所有插件✅ 正确做法按需引入所需功能模块错误处理机制建立完善的错误监控和处理流程网络异常处理解码错误恢复播放失败重试扩展开发自定义功能实现ArtPlayer提供了灵活的插件开发机制你可以基于现有架构开发定制功能自定义控制组件特殊效果插件业务逻辑集成总结为什么ArtPlayer值得你投入学习通过本文的讲解相信你已经对ArtPlayer有了全面的认识。它不仅解决了传统视频播放的诸多痛点更为开发者提供了一个功能强大且易于扩展的平台。无论你是前端新手还是资深开发者ArtPlayer都能为你提供稳定可靠的视频播放解决方案。现在就开始实践将ArtPlayer应用到你的下一个项目中吧【免费下载链接】ArtPlayer:art: ArtPlayer.js is a modern and full featured HTML5 video player项目地址: https://gitcode.com/gh_mirrors/ar/ArtPlayer创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考